Lansing is Michigan’s state capital and a major automotive manufacturing hub in its own right. I-96 running east-west connects Lansing directly to Detroit and Grand Rapids, while I-69 running north-south links the city to Flint and the Canadian border crossings to the north and Fort Wayne and Indianapolis to the south. GM’s Lansing Grand River Assembly and Lansing Delta Township Assembly plants — producing Cadillac CT4, CT5, and Chevy Colorado — anchor a deep supplier ecosystem throughout Ingham and Eaton counties generating consistent flatbed and delivery truck demand year-round. The Lansing Truck Market

Lansing’s dual identity as Michigan’s state capital and a major GM manufacturing hub gives it a uniquely diverse truck market. The GM Lansing Grand River Assembly and Delta Township Assembly plants collectively produce hundreds of thousands of vehicles per year, anchoring a Tier 1 and Tier 2 supplier network throughout Ingham and Eaton counties that generates consistent flatbed and just-in-time delivery truck demand. The state government’s large contractor ecosystem adds further service truck and utility vehicle demand throughout the capital area.

Lansing’s I-96 position midway between Detroit and Grand Rapids — with I-69 providing direct connections to Flint and the Fort Wayne/Indianapolis corridor — makes it a natural waypoint and distribution hub for Central Michigan.
